anyone in the future looking for wind shield, polishing, clear, faded, my add to the tape trick, do the whole screen, one side then the other, gently rub the tape in, then start at one side and peel the whole side off. You can tell if you got the coating as the tape will just come off easily. IF you already did that spot, it will leave glue residue behind, and that my friend, is a bitch to remove.
Remove it from the frame as well before starting
Starting randomly I could see improvement but lost track of what I'd done. edge to edge the only way to go.

I had good luck by laying a wet towel on the side to be stripped for a half hour or so, then quickly drying it off and putting the tape on.  Seemed to loosen it up a bit, like removing a decal from a model.
